Random sequential adsorption of shrinking or expanding particles
Arsen V Subashiev1, Serge Luryi
1Department of Electrical and Computer Engineering, State University of New York at Stony Brook, Stony Brook, New York 11794-2350, USA.
Abstract:
We present a model of one-dimensional irreversible adsorption in which particles once adsorbed immediately shrink to a smaller size or expand to a larger size. Exact solutions for the fill factor and the particle number variance as a function of the size change are obtained. Results are compared with approximate analytical solutions.
